How The ICE Immigration Detainer Process Works | AllLaw
An immigration detainer is a request by ICE for a local law enforcement agency to hold an arrested immigrant who is suspected of violating immigration laws for a period of 48 hours after the time they would otherwise be released. How to Help an ICE Detainee in an Immigration Hold | AllLaw
An immigration hold (also called a detainer) refers to when an undocumented or illegal immigrant who is already in jail is held after a criminal charge, often past the person's scheduled release date, for transfer to Immigration and Customs Enforcement ( ICE ). The hold lasts for 48 hours, during which time ICE is supposed to pick the person up.

DHS/ICE/PIA-019 Online Detainee Locator System
The Online Detainee Locator System (ODLS) is a publicly accessible, Web-based system owned by U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E). ODLS allows the public to conduct online Internet-based queries to locate persons detained by ICE for civil violations of the Immigration and Nationality Act.

How to locate a person held in the U.S. prison or immigration ... - ICIJ
In order to search, you need either the person’s Alien Registration Number (“A number”) or name and country of birth. If you see that the person’s status is “not in custody,” that means the person was released from ICE custody within the last 60 days. Krome North Service Processing Center | ICE
Miami Field Office. If you need information about a detainee that is housed at this facility, you may call (305) 207-2001 between the hours of 8 a.m. and 4 p.m. When you call, please have the individual’s biographical information ready, including first, last and hyphenated names, any aliases he or she may use, date of birth and country of birth.
